Description
Technical field
The utility model belongs to air spinning techniques field, especially puts yarn feeding device with a kind of open-end spinning blank pipe around yarn relevant.
Background technology
In spinning process, need to take off full package cylinder yarn after the full package of cylinder yarn, change empty spool.Current semi-automatic open-end spinning frame blank pipe is when yarn, and usually adopt artificial first around filling on the spool of sky, use the loose thread of filling to carry out drawing yarn and realize joint, workman's amount of labour is large, and production efficiency is low.
Utility model content
The purpose of this utility model be intended to overcome existing semi-automatic open-end spinning frame blank pipe around yarn time the workman amount of labour large, the defect that production efficiency is low, provide a kind of blank pipe around yarn time can realize automatically putting yarn open-end spinning blank pipe put yarn feeding device around yarn.
For this reason, the utility model is by the following technical solutions: a kind of open-end spinning blank pipe puts yarn feeding device around yarn, it is characterized in that, described yarn feeding device of putting comprises Xi Sha mechanism and Fang Sha mechanism, Xi Sha mechanism comprises linear electric motors, suction nozzle, send yarn bar and the first stepper motor, suction nozzle is fixedly connected on the motor shaft front end of described linear electric motors, the forward end of suction nozzle is provided with suction nozzle mouth, the rear end of suction nozzle is connected with a negative pressure device, suction nozzle is tandem motion under the driving of described linear electric motors, make described suction nozzle mouth can near or away from yarn, described send yarn rod rear end to be installed on described first stepping motor rotating shaft to be swung by this first driving stepper motor, yarn bar forward end is sent to be provided with a twizzle, described Fang Sha mechanism comprises puts yarn arm, the second stepper motor and transmission mechanism, put yarn arm top to be installed by a rotating shaft support, second stepper motor is connected with described rotating shaft transmission by described transmission mechanism, put yarn arm by the second driving stepper motor to swing centered by described rotating shaft, the bottom of putting yarn arm described in making can move back and forth described sending above yarn bar front end and bobbin cradle.
As to technique scheme supplement and perfect, the utility model also comprises following technical characteristic.
Described transmission mechanism is belt gear or gear drive.
During utility model works, suction nozzle is under the driving of linear electric motors, with the motor shaft rectilinear motion of linear electric motors, until the suction nozzle mouth of described suction nozzle is near yarn place, under the effect of described negative pressure device, suction nozzle mouth place is made to produce negative pressure, yarn is sucked in suction nozzle, then the first stepper motor and the second stepper motor is started, put yarn arm bottom described in second driving stepper motor to move towards described suction nozzle place, send yarn bar to rotate described in first driving stepper motor simultaneously, make to send yarn bar yarn to be hooked feeding and put yarn arm bottom, put yarn arm bottom thread grip is lived, and make to put yarn arm backswing under the driving of described second stepper motor, make to put the upper right side that yarn arm bottom moves to bobbin cradle, band toothholder disc spins on bobbin cradle, yarn is linked in blank pipe, move around under the effect of traversing yarn-guide mouth, realize around yarn.
The utility model is by arranging Xi Sha mechanism and the cooperation of Fang Sha mechanism, following beneficial effect can be reached: yarn automatically can be sent into from Yin Shasha road the enterprising line space pipe of bobbin cradle around yarn, reduce working strength and the amount of labour used of workman, improve operating efficiency, reduce production cost simultaneously.
